Generative AI: Unleashing Creativity and Efficiency

Generative Artificial Intelligence (AI) is at the forefront of technological innovation, and it's set to make a significant impact in 2024. This technology goes beyond traditional AI systems by creating content, designs, and solutions autonomously. It's like having a creative assistant that can generate art, music, and even code.


In the creative realm, generative AI is revolutionising content creation. From generating artwork to composing music, AI algorithms are learning to mimic human creativity. This isn't about replacing artists or musicians; it's about augmenting their capabilities and providing new avenues for creative expression.


From a practical standpoint, generative AI streamlines various processes. Whether it's automating data analysis, generating complex reports, or even designing user interfaces, AI's ability to produce high-quality content efficiently is a game-changer. In 2024, businesses will increasingly harness generative AI to enhance productivity and unleash new levels of creativity.

Sustainable Technology: Tech for a Greener Future

Sustainability has become a paramount concern, and technology is playing a pivotal role in addressing environmental challenges. In 2024, sustainable technology will take centre stage as industries seek eco-friendly solutions.


Renewable energy sources, such as solar and wind power, will continue to advance with improved efficiency and affordability. Smart grid systems will enhance energy distribution, reducing waste and minimising environmental impact. Electric vehicles (EVs) will see increased adoption, with enhanced battery technology extending their range and affordability.


Circular economy practices, enabled by technology, will gain prominence. From recycling and waste reduction to sustainable supply chain management, businesses will strive to minimise their ecological footprint.


Moreover, sustainable technology extends to data centres, with a focus on energy-efficient server farms and eco-friendly cooling solutions. In 2024, expect technology to drive positive change towards a greener future.

Cybersecurity and Cyber Resilience: Fortifying Digital Defences

As technology advances, so do the threats in the digital landscape. Cybersecurity and cyber resilience will remain critical concerns in 2024.


With the proliferation of data breaches and cyberattacks, organisations are doubling down on security measures. Advanced threat detection systems, artificial intelligence-driven security tools, and zero-trust architectures will become mainstream in safeguarding sensitive data.


Cyber resilience, the ability to bounce back from cyber incidents, will also gain prominence. Businesses will invest in robust backup and recovery solutions, coupled with comprehensive incident response plans. The focus is not only on preventing attacks but also on ensuring business continuity in the face of adversity.


In a world where digital assets are increasingly valuable, cybersecurity and cyber resilience will be non-negotiable for organisations of all sizes.

Accelerating Digital Transformation: Adapting to the Digital Age

2024 will be a pivotal year for digital transformation. The COVID-19 pandemic accelerated the shift toward digitalisation, and this trend will persist.


Businesses will continue to invest in cloud computing, leveraging the flexibility and scalability it offers. The Internet of Things (IoT) will expand further, connecting an array of devices and enabling data-driven decision-making. Edge computing will gain traction as a means to process data closer to its source, reducing latency and enhancing real-time capabilities.


Artificial intelligence and automation will permeate various industries, from healthcare and finance to manufacturing and logistics. The goal is to enhance efficiency, streamline processes, and improve customer experiences.
